This is a great versatile dress for all occasions. I bought this dress for a gala and then wore it two weeks later for Easter. The belt was a bit snug but it helped create an hourglass figure. Also, you need a safety pin or tape so that the top does not open up and reveal too much. I received so many compliments on the dress. It gives you a very Marilyn Monroe look.
This coat fits a little big and is somewhat boxy. I also wish it had one more closure at the top. The picture shows it buttoned all the way up and is accurate to how it basically looks and fits. I am keeping it because it overall is a great price for a soft luxurious coat. I'm 5'9, 140 lbs and got a size 6
This would be a nice enough dress and if it were less. This material is a sheer very delicate cotton like material (think really thin C&C California style), and in no way justifies the price. The fit was also a bit small, I'm usually a 0-2, and got a 2, which fit, but would've probably been more comfortable in a 4.

Perfect dress - This is the perfect dress...the pictures do not do it justice. Trust me when I say that you will feel amazing. Super flattering...and even more comfortable. You can size up or down 1 size as it is a forgiving style and drapes beautifully. First Halston purchase. I did not tie a bow like the picture which gave it a more modern feel (knot). Also found it in a mauve (more lavender) color so purchased that as well...love this dress. Very picky shopper.
